Parsovanie .java zdrojakov cestou najmensieho odporu

2010-04-14 Tema obsahu Dusan Zatkovsky
Ahoj. Maintainujem qtjambi/maven plugin a stojim pred rozhodnutim ci/a/alebo cim parsovat javovske zdrojaky. V principe mi ide o extrakciu textov k prekladu ( pokial niekto pouziva qt/qtjambi, ide mi o nahradu toolu lupdate ). Priklad: public class MainClass extends SomeObject {

Re: Parsovanie .java zdrojakov cestou najmensieho odporu

2010-04-14 Tema obsahu Petr Prochazka
A co parsovat bytecode pres ASM http://asm.ow2.org/? Zda se mi to jako nejlepsi cesta. Parsovat zdrojaky bych uvazoval az jako posledni vec. Pokud to nelze, kouknul bych napr. do Findbugshttp://findbugs.sourceforge.net/nebo Clirr http://clirr.sourceforge.net/ jestli tam nebude neco pouzitelneho...

Re: Parsovanie .java zdrojakov cestou najmensieho odporu

2010-04-14 Tema obsahu Dusan Zatkovsky
On Wednesday 14 of April 2010 13:04:42 Petr Prochazka wrote: Na to asm sa pozriem, vychadzal som z predpokladu, ze za tak masivnou podporou refactoringu a kontrole syntaxe v IDE-ckach je cosi, co by mozno slo pouzit... D -- Dusan ... tykajte mi

Re: Parsovanie .java zdrojakov cestou najmensieho odporu

2010-04-14 Tema obsahu Petr Prochazka
Idea ma podporu pro export string konstant do properties souboru (nebo jenom konstant? presne ted nevim), ale ja osobne to zatim jeste nepouzil. Eclipse a NB nevim, moc je nepouzivam... Jinak o nicem takovem nevim... Petr Prochazka 2010/4/14 Dusan Zatkovsky msk.c...@gmail.com On Wednesday 14

RE: Parsovanie .java zdrojakov cestou najmensieho odporu

2010-04-14 Tema obsahu Tomas Hubalek
Určitě by měl jít použít AntLR. Gramatika pro Javu už je hotová, netřeba ji vymýšlet znova. A nedávno jsem narazil ještě na tohle, to by mohlo být ještě jednodušší než AntLR http://code.google.com/p/javaparser/wiki/UsingThisParser Tom -Original Message- From:

Re: Parsovanie .java zdrojakov cestou najmensieho odporu

2010-04-14 Tema obsahu Rastislav Siekel
Eclipse má tiez( moz(nost( Externalize Strings Týka sa to String kons(tánt, aj Stringov vo volaní metód. Ak to chcete jednorazovo... Rastislav Bedo Siekel Ing. Rastislav Siekel Prosoft s.r.o., Kuzmányho 8, 010 01

RE: Parsovanie .java zdrojakov cestou najmensieho odporu

2010-04-14 Tema obsahu Polak Michal
Na to asm sa pozriem, vychadzal som z predpokladu, ze za tak masivnou podporou refactoringu a kontrole syntaxe v IDE-ckach je cosi, co by mozno slo pouzit... Eclipse obsahuje JDT (Java Development Tools) - pomoci tohoto je v Eclipsu provaden refactoring a dalsi. Mimo jine obsahuje i parser

Re: Parsovanie .java zdrojakov cestou najmensieho odporu

2010-04-14 Tema obsahu Dusan Zatkovsky
On Wednesday 14 of April 2010 14:46:50 Dusan Zatkovsky wrote: Bingo! Musim uznat, ze som sa tomu venoval tak 15 minut a mam to s javaparser skoro hotove! Diky diky. Keby to niekoho zaujimalo, moze sa inspirovat: File src = new File(src/main/java/test/App.java);

Hibernate OneToOne Lazy

2010-04-14 Tema obsahu Ondra Medek
Ahoj, Mám v Hibernate dvě entity spojené přes nepovinný bidirectional OneToOne vztah: USER (owning, EAGER) -- EMPLOYEE (referenced, LAZY). Bohužel i na referenced side se generuje eager select, viz http://community.jboss.org/wiki/Someexplanationsonlazyloadingone-to-one Jak podobné případy

Re: Hibernate OneToOne Lazy

2010-04-14 Tema obsahu Lukas Barton
Pokud si pamatuju, tak kdyz je cizi klic v jine tabulce a je to 0..1, tak Hibernate musi tu query udelat. Protoze nevi, jestli tam ma byt null nebo proxy. Lukas 2010/4/14 Ondra Medek xmed...@gmail.com Ahoj, Mám v Hibernate dvě entity spojené přes nepovinný bidirectional OneToOne vztah:

Re: Hibernate OneToOne Lazy

2010-04-14 Tema obsahu Ondra Medek
Pokud si pamatuju, tak kdyz je cizi klic v jine tabulce a je to 0..1, tak Hibernate musi tu query udelat. Protoze nevi, jestli tam ma byt null nebo proxy. JJ, to je popsané zde http://community.jboss.org/wiki/Someexplanationsonlazyloadingone-to-one ale existuje nějaký workaround nebo jak